您尚未
登入
註冊
忘記密碼
搜尋
贊助
贊助本站
數位公仔
紀念T恤
紀念馬克杯
廣告
刊登廣告
廣告價格
線上申請刊登
用雅幣刊登
免費刊登
目前客戶
簡訊
簡訊說明
購買金幣
發送簡訊
預約簡訊
發送記錄
好友通訊
罐頭簡訊
論命
數位論命舘
免費排盤工具
葫蘆墩 優生造命
葫蘆墩 八字命書
影音論命(葫蘆墩)
影音占卜(葫蘆墩)
購買金幣
星座分析
孔明神數
周公解夢
星僑線上論命
娛樂
影 像 行 腳
數 位 造 型
數 位 畫 廊
心 情 日 記
公 益 彩 券
送生日蛋糕
俄羅斯方塊
四 川 省
猜 數 字
比 大 小
泡 泡 龍
許 願 池
萬 年 曆
經 期 計 算
體 重 測 量
音 樂 點 播
衛 星 地 圖
時間戳字幕
男女聊天室
求助
論壇守則
會員等級
會員權限
語法教學
常見問題
最新活動
打工賺雅幣
首頁
新版首頁(全頁)
傳統首頁(全頁)
新版首頁(選單)
傳統首頁(選單)
MyChat 數位男女
命理風水
15
星僑五術軟體
4
葫蘆墩命理網
5
命理問答
9
四柱八字
1
紫微斗數
1
姓名學
手面相
易經占卜
1
風水研討
1
擇日&三式
1
西洋占星
無視論塔羅牌
10
修行&武術
1
中醫研討
五術哈啦
1
電腦資訊
13
硬體討論
5
超頻 & 開箱
3
數位生活
2
PDA 討論
手機討論區
軟體推薦
2
軟體討論
6
Apple 討論
1
Unix-like
網路&防毒
2
程式設計
網站架設
4
電腦教學資源
生活休閒
14
休閒哈啦
7
感情世界
2
上班一族
5
國考&法律
7
生活醫學
4
運動體育
1
單車討論
1
釣魚討論
6
旅遊討論
4
天文觀星
3
攝影分享
8
圖片分享
4
數位影視
2
笑話集錦
3
興趣嗜好
13
文學散文
7
繪圖藝術
1
布袋戲
3
動漫畫討論
3
美食天地
6
理財專區
心理測驗
1
汽、機車
3
寵物園地
模型&手工藝
4
花卉園藝
魔術方塊
獨輪車專區
電玩遊戲
13
遊戲歡樂包
4
CS討論
8
Steam
3
MineCraft
2
東方Project
英雄聯盟LOL
1
單機遊戲
2
WebGame
3
線上遊戲1
6
線上遊戲2
5
電視遊樂器
1
掌上型遊戲
2
模擬器遊戲
1
工商服務
6
虛擬城市
7
好康分享
新品販售
二手拍賣
1
租屋&找屋
工商建議區
1
站務專區
10
最新活動
活動成果
數位造型
心情日記
個人圖庫
新人報到練習
論壇問題建議
1
榮會及電子報討論
-最近版區-
-最近瀏覽-
»
程式設計
»
JAVA~~~拜托幫幫忙
手機版
訂閱
地圖
簡體
您是第
2941
個閱讀者
可列印版
加為IE收藏
收藏主題
上一主題
|
下一主題
文心
級別:
小人物
x0
x8
分享:
▼
x
0
[Java] JAVA~~~拜托幫幫忙
題目是: 設計一個含有length及width屬性的rectangle類別, 而且這兩種屬性預設值是1.該類別具有可計算矩形的perimeter(周長)及area(面積)的方法.當然也必須提供length和width的set及get方法. set方法應該要能夠檢查length及width都是否為浮點數. 且其值會大於0.0而小於20.0.
請幫我把???部份寫出來好嗎 謝謝
class Rectangle
{
in ..
訪客只能看到部份內容,免費
加入會員
或由臉書
Google
可以看到全部內容
終於上大學了~~感覺好特別唷
x
0
[樓 主]
From:台灣 和信超媒體寬帶網 |
Posted:
2006-06-02 01:08 |
奉茶
級別:
小人物
x0
x21
分享:
▲
▼
class rectangle{
private double length = 1;
private double width = 1;
private String str = null;
public rectangle(double l,double w,String s){
length = l; width = w; str = s;
}
public double Length(){
return length;
}
public double Width(){
return width;
}
public setLength(double length){
if(length > 0.0 && length < 20.0)
this.length = length;
}
public setWidth(double width){
if(width > 0.0 && width < 20.0)
this.width = width;
}
public String Print(){
return width + str + "x" + height + str;
}
public String Perimeter(){
return ((length+width)*2) + str;
}
public String Area(){
return (length * width) + "平方" + str;
}
}
x
0
[1 樓]
From:台灣和信超媒體 |
Posted:
2006-06-02 13:07 |
文心
級別:
小人物
x0
x8
分享:
▲
▼
謝謝你的回答唷~~~
不過可不可以問一下這個是要放在我上面題目的問號裡面嗎
終於上大學了~~感覺好特別唷
x
0
[2 樓]
From:台灣 和信超媒體寬帶網 |
Posted:
2006-06-05 15:08 |
奉茶
級別:
小人物
x0
x21
分享:
▲
▼
這是給你參考的
你要自己稍微修改一下^^
x
0
[3 樓]
From:台灣和信超媒體 |
Posted:
2006-06-06 12:51 |
文心
級別:
小人物
x0
x8
分享:
▲
▼
OK了解~~~感謝你的頂力相助
終於上大學了~~感覺好特別唷
x
0
[4 樓]
From:印度尼西亞 |
Posted:
2006-06-06 16:44 |
文心
級別:
小人物
x0
x8
分享:
▲
▼
class Rectangle
{
double length,width; //長,寬
String unit; //單位
private double length = 1;
private double width = 1;
private String unit = null;
{
public rectangle (double l,double w,String u);
}
{
length = l;
width = w;
unit = u;
}
public double Length()
{
return length;
}
public double Width()
{
return width;
}
public void length(double length);
{
if(length > 0.0 && length < 20.0)
this.length = length;
}
public void width(double width);
{
if(width > 0.0 && width < 20.0)
this.width = width;
}
public String Print()
{
System.out.print("\n");
return("長方形:"+length+unit+"*"+width+unit);
}
public String Area()
{
System.out.print("\n");
return("長方形面積:"+(width*length)+"平方"+unit);
}
public String Length()
{
System.out.print("\n");
return("長方形周長:"+(length+width)*2+unit);
}
}
class rectangle1
{
public static void main(String args[])
{
Rectangle r1=new Rectangle(12,10,"公分");
r1.Print(); // 長方形:12公分x10公分
r1.Area(); // 長方形面積:120 平方公分
r1.Length(); // 長方形周長:44 公分
Rectangle r2=new Rectangle(5,6,"公尺");
r2.Print(); // 長方形:5公尺x6公尺
r2.Area(); // 長方形面積:30 平方公尺
r2.Length(); // 長方形周長:22 公尺
}
}
/*
長方形:12公分x10公分
長方形面積:120 平方公分
長方形周長:44 公分
長方形:5公尺x6公尺
長方形面積:30 平方公尺
長方形周長:22 公尺
press any key to continue...
*/
終於上大學了~~感覺好特別唷
x
0
[5 樓]
From:印度尼西亞 |
Posted:
2006-06-06 17:20 |
文心
級別:
小人物
x0
x8
分享:
▲
▼
那可以請問一下我這樣有那裡錯了嗎~~~拜托了~~~
終於上大學了~~感覺好特別唷
x
0
[6 樓]
From:印度尼西亞 |
Posted:
2006-06-06 17:20 |
奉茶
級別:
小人物
x0
x21
分享:
▲
▼
幫你改好了^^"
原來我之前也犯了一些錯誤
class InvalidRangeException extends Exception{}
class Rectangle
{
private double length = 1,width = 1; //長,寬
String unit = null; //單位
public Rectangle (double l,double w,String u){
length = l;
width = w;
unit = u;
}
public double Length()
{
return length;
}
public double Width()
{
return width;
}
public void length(double length) throws InvalidRangeException
{
if(length > 0.0 && length < 20.0)
this.length = length;
else
throw new InvalidRangeException();
}
public void width(double width) throws InvalidRangeException
{
if(width > 0.0 && width < 20.0)
this.width = width;
else
throw new InvalidRangeException();
}
public void Print()
{
System.out.println();
System.out.println("長方形:"+length+unit+"*"+width+unit);
}
public void Area()
{
System.out.println();
System.out.println("長方形面積:"+(width*length)+"平方"+unit);
}
public void perimeter()
{
System.out.println();
System.out.println("長方形周長:"+(length+width)*2+unit);
}
}
class rectangle1
{
public static void main(String args[])
{
Rectangle r1=new Rectangle(12,10,"公分");
r1.Print(); // 長方形:12公分x10公分
r1.Area(); // 長方形面積:120 平方公分
r1.perimeter(); // 長方形周長:44 公分
Rectangle r2=new Rectangle(5,6,"公尺");
r2.Print(); // 長方形:5公尺x6公尺
r2.Area(); // 長方形面積:30 平方公尺
r2.perimeter(); // 長方形周長:22 公尺
}
}
自己compile看看
我就是沒有自己compile才會沒注意到有錯誤^^"
[ 此文章被奉茶在2006-06-07 08:28重新編輯 ]
此文章被評分,最近評分記錄
財富:20 (by codeboy) | 理由:
熱心助人...感謝您的回覆喔..^^
x
1
[7 樓]
From:台灣和信超媒體 |
Posted:
2006-06-07 07:51 |
文心
級別:
小人物
x0
x8
分享:
▲
因為你的頂力幫助~~~~我的java才不致於當掉~~~~謝謝
終於上大學了~~感覺好特別唷
x
0
[8 樓]
From:印度尼西亞 |
Posted:
2006-06-07 13:40 |
MyChat 數位男女
»
程式設計
Powered by
PHPWind
v1.3.6
Copyright © 2003-04
PHPWind
Processed in 0.021941 second(s),query:16 Gzip disabled
本站由
瀛睿律師事務所
擔任常年法律顧問 |
免責聲明
|
本網站已依台灣網站內容分級規定處理
|
連絡我們
|
訪客留言